100g of naan contain about 311 calories (kcal).
Calories per:
ounce
| one naan
For instance, a medium size naan (200 g) contain about 622 calories.
This is about 31% of the daily caloric intake for an average adult with medium weight and activity level (assuming a 2000 kcal daily intake).

100g of Naan
Nutrition
- Calories311
- Carbs Total50.23 g
- Dietary fiber5.2 g
- Fat7.28 g
- Protein11.09 g
- Water29.24 g
Vitamins
- Vit B1 (Thiamine)0.153 mg
- Vit B2 (riboflavin)0.196 mg
- Vit B3 (Niacin)3.891 mg
- Vit B60.139 mg
- Vit B9 (Folic acid)0.015 mcg
- Vit E1.44 mg
- Vit K0.004 mg
Minerals
- Potassium201 mg
- Magnessium74 mg
- Calcium64 mg
- Sodium508 mg
- Iron1.88 mg

Calories and Macronutrients
One serving of naan bread contains approximately 311 calories. This calorie count is a crucial figure for those monitoring their daily intake for weight management or health reasons. The macronutrients break down as follows:
- Carbohydrates: 50.23g, with 5.2g of fiber and 3.7g of sugar, making it a significant source of carbs. The fiber content is beneficial for digestive health.
- Protein: 11.09g, which is quite substantial for bread. Protein is essential for muscle repair and growth.
- Fat: 7.28g, with a minimal amount of saturated fat, indicating that most of the fat content is healthier unsaturated fats.
Minerals and Vitamins
Naan is not just about macronutrients; it also offers a variety of vitamins and minerals essential for body functions:
- Calcium and Iron: With 64mg of calcium and 1.88mg of iron, naan contributes to bone health and oxygen transport in the blood, respectively.
- Magnesium: At 74mg, it aids in muscle and nerve function, blood sugar control, and blood pressure regulation.
- Potassium: With 201mg, it's vital for heart and kidney function.
- Vitamins B1, B2, B3, and B6: These support brain health, energy levels, and overall cell function.
Considerations for a Healthy Diet
While naan can be a nutritious component of your diet, it's important to consider its sodium content (508mg) and calories in the context of your overall dietary needs. The relatively high sodium content means that moderation is key, especially for those with blood pressure concerns.
Moreover, the carbs in naan make it a high-energy food, which is excellent for active individuals but should be balanced with other low-carb options throughout the day for those watching their carbohydrate intake.
